We have a W2K3 CA so generating user certificates is relatively
easy... but what's the best way to install and configure the certs on
each PC? The mail profiles will be automatically generated on logon
using the CIW but I can't see how to add the certs automatically.

Signing Certs aren't stored in Outlook. They're stored in the Windows Crypto store that you can see either in IE's Tools>Internet Options>Content>Certificates or from the Management Console certmgr.msc
